关系规范化练习题_第1页
关系规范化练习题_第2页
关系规范化练习题_第3页
全文预览已结束

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、一、单一选择题1.正则化理论是关系数据库逻辑设计的理论基础。根据牙齿理论,关系数据库内的关系必须得到满足。每个属性都是()。A.没有相互相关的b .不可分离C.可变长度d .相互关联2.在关系模式下,2NF表示_ _ _ _ _ _ _ _ _ _ _。A.符合1NF,没有非主属性到代码传递相关性B.1NF满足和郑智薰主属性到代码部分无相关性C.符合1NF,没有非主属性D.符合1NF,没有组合属性3.在关系模式下,3NF表示_ _ _ _ _ _ _ _ _ _ _ _ _ _ _。A.符合2NF,没有与代码的郑智薰主属性传递相关性B.2NF满足和郑智薰主属性到代码部分无相关性C.符合2NF,

2、没有非主属性D.符合2NF,没有组合属性4.关系模型期间,关系模式至少为()。A.1NF B.2NF C.3NF D.BCNF5.关系模式R(A,C,D)牙齿具有函数相关性AC,AD,候选代码为_ _ _ _ _,关系模式R(A,C,)6.如果关系模式R(A、B、C、D)具有函数相关性AB、AC,AD,(B,C)A牙齿,则候选代码为_1.关系标准化的操作例外是什么?那是什么引起的?解决方案是什么?2.第一范式,第二范式,第三范式关系的定义是什么?什么是第三部分依赖?什么是传递依赖性?请举例说明。4.第三范式表必须不包含部分从属关系吗?5.对于主键仅由一个属性组成的关系,如果是第一个范式关系,则

3、应该是第二个范式关系吗?6.有关系模型:学生选择课程(学号、名字、材质、性别、课程编号、课程名称、学分、成绩)。安装一名学生后,可以选修多门课程、一个课程等多门学生选修课。一名学生有自己的学科,每个课程有自己的课程名称和学分。指出牙齿关系模式的候选密钥,判断牙齿关系模式是第几个范式。如果不是第三范式牙齿,则规范化到第三范式关系模式,并表示分解的每个关系模式的主键和外键。7.设定关系模式:学生表(学号、名字、素材、班号、班主任、系主任),意思是一名学生只在一个系的一个班学习,一个系只有一名系主任,一个班只有一名班主任,一个系可以有多个班。指出牙齿关系模式的候选密钥,判断牙齿关系模式是第几个范式。

4、如果不是第三范式牙齿,则规范化到第三范式关系模式,并表示分解的每个关系模式的主键和外键。8.有关系模式:授课西餐(课程编号、课程名称、学分、授课教师编号、教师名称、授课时间)有确定的课程名称和学分(由课程编号确定),每个教师(由教师编号确定)有确定的教师名称,并指出牙齿关系模式的候选关键字,牙齿关系模式属于第几个范式如果不属于第三个范式,请用第三个范式关系模式规范化,并指出分解的每个关系模式的主键和外键。9.已知关系模式为s(sno、sname、sex、sdeptno)。Sdept(sdeptno,sdeptname)。有人把它设计成关系模式SS。Ss (SnO、sname、sex、s deptno、sdeptname)1.SS的主代码是?2.多少范式?为什么10.在商业组数据库过程中,假定关系模型R牙齿如下:r(商店编号、商品编号、商品库存数量、部门编号、负责人)规定时:各商店的各商品只在该商店的一个部门销售。每个商店的每个部门只有一个负责人。每个商店的商品只有一个库存数量。请回答以下问题:(1)根据上述规定,列出关系模式R的基本函数

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论